Cyathea andersonii (J. Scott ex. Bedd.) Copel.

 
  • Family : CYATHEACEAE
    (Cyathea Family)
  • Family (as per The APG System III) : CYATHEACEAE
  • Basionym : Alsophila andersonii J. Scott ex. Bedd.
  • Species Name (as per The IPNI) : Unresolved name
  • Habit : Tree
  • Key identification features : Tree fern; Stipe ebeneous, clothed near the base with lanceolate deciduous scales; rachis dark, chestnut coloured, below naked and rough with raised points, tawny-villose above. Sori infra-medial, minute, exindusiate.
  • Fertile : September
  • Distribution :
    • Odisha : Keonjhar district, Kotagarh Wildlife Sanctuary (Kandhamal district), Phulbani district
  • World Distribution : India, Bhutan, China
  • Conservation Status : Not Evaluated (NE)
